Most needles contain a special sleeve or cannula that prevents significant blood loss as the needle is inserted. After the phlebotomist has put the needle in the vessel, a collection tube is attached that creates the negative pressure needed to draw blood out of the body. Some sites offer practice tests, with subsequent access to the correct answers, so the student can get ready for the certification examination. Others offer helpful posts or community newsgroups where a student can get their study questions answered by practicing phlebotomists.
Many phlebotomists prefer to get at least an associate's degree, though, which may be completed at a community college in four semesters (two years) for about $1,000 per term. Some phlebotomists in Martinsburg even get bachelor's degrees in clinical and lab technology, which supplies added advice and training about the more specialized positions, not merely phlebotomy.
